2000 Honda Shuttle vs. 2000 TVR Cerbera Speed 12

To start off, both 2000 Honda Shuttle and 2000 TVR Cerbera Speed 12 were released in the same year (2000). Therefore the support and the availability on parts for both vehicles should be relatively similar. At 7,730 cc (12 cylinders), 2000 TVR Cerbera Speed 12 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2000 TVR Cerbera Speed 12 (800 HP @ 7250 RPM) has 652 more horse power than 2000 Honda Shuttle. (148 HP @ 5700 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2000 TVR Cerbera Speed 12 should accelerate faster than 2000 Honda Shuttle.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2000 Honda Shuttle weights approximately 455 kg more than 2000 TVR Cerbera Speed 12.

Because 2000 TVR Cerbera Speed 12 is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 2000 TVR Cerbera Speed 12.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2000 Honda Shuttle,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2000 TVR Cerbera Speed 12 (881 Nm @ 5750 RPM) has 675 more torque (in Nm) than 2000 Honda Shuttle. (206 Nm @ 4700 RPM). This means 2000 TVR Cerbera Speed 12 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2000 Honda Shuttle. 2000 Honda Shuttle has automatic transmission and 2000 TVR Cerbera Speed 12 has manual transmission. 2000 TVR Cerbera Speed 12 will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 2000 Honda Shuttle will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.

Compare all specifications:

2000 Honda Shuttle 2000 TVR Cerbera Speed 12
Make Honda TVR
Model Shuttle Cerbera Speed 12
Year Released 2000 2000
Body Type Minivan Coupe
Engine Position Front Front
Engine Size 2254 cc 7730 cc
Engine Cylinders 4 cylinders 12 cylinders
Engine Type in-line V
Horse Power 148 HP 800 HP
Engine RPM 5700 RPM 7250 RPM
Torque 206 Nm 881 Nm
Torque RPM 4700 RPM 5750 RPM
Engine Compression Ratio 9.5:1 12.5:1
Drive Type Front Rear
Transmission Type Automatic Manual
Number of Seats 6 seats 2 seats
Number of Doors 5 doors 2 doors
Vehicle Weight 1525 kg 1070 kg
Wheelbase Size 2840 mm 2570 mm
Fuel Tank Capacity 65 L 57 L
